It is known to us that English is not as old as Chinese, but it is widely used by most people all over the world. English speakers enjoy creating new words. In fact, a majority of words are traceable and each of them may have an interesting story.
However, no one will really care where a word comes from because it makes little difference in using them in our daily life. Did you ever feel confused about why hamburgers are called hamburgers, especially when they are not made with ham?
About a hundred years ago, some men went to America from Europe, coming from a big city in Germany called Hamburg. They didn’t know how to use English properly. Having seen them eating round pieces of beef, the American asked what it was. The Germans didn’t understand the questions exactly, so they answered, "We come from Hamburg. " One of the Americans was an owner of a restaurant and got an idea. He cooked some round pieces of bread with beef and began selling them. Such bread came to be called "hamburgers".
